There are so many factors to look at when building a stroker motor. Everything from intake to cams to rev limit to exhaust. It all plays a role in the complete motor idea. Some  are compression and what type of tuning are you going to use, AFM, MAF, MAP or Alpha N with a custom chip or stand alone system. Street car/track car on pump gas or track car on race gas. Custom pistons and rods or other sources that will work without going new/custom.

To date I don't know of any kit that is available for the M42. Many people have done so many different combinations of components. You can definitely fit a lot of stock BMW parts from other models in our motors as well as parts intended for other car manufacturers. I have personally done both.  You can learn so much from getting all the information and figuring out what will work:-)

While planning my motor I had thought everything through several times making sure that is the best possible direction for me. Custom cams were a must for me. Porting was another one since the power is in the head. Stand alone management to handle the Alpha N and MAP blending with added compression along with an E30M3 exhaust system to get all that flow out of the motor. The valve train has been lightened with 33mm lifters, beehive springs, and 6mm valve stem valves. Pistons were cut and pocketed and dished to match cams and change in stroke along with getting the proper compression. The other major one is if you go the M47 crank route, you'll need to turn down the nose as well as cut a second keyway.  I also lightened my crank at the same time. Everything that was touched was either lightened or improved upon. You can go with other avenues and just change pistons or pistons and crank and rods. Many many variables according to what your budget is.

Go to http://www.metricmechanic.com/prices/pricing-engines-kits.php and scroll down about 3/4 of the page.

M42 & M44 Engine Kits - M42: E30 318is '90-'91, E36 '92-'95, Z3 '95 M44: E36 318ti '96-'98, E36 318i '96-'98, Z3 '96-'98
 
2000 HiFlo ST Sport M42/M44 Engine Kit 160-170 HP $3,435 + Full Kit Discount
  HiFlo ST Sport Head*, 6% Flow Increase   $1,495 $600
  Head Upgrade, from 7mm to 6mm Valvetrain   $300  
  Sport Intake Camshaft   $450  
  Head Gasket   $110  
  Pistons, Sport 87mm Forged Alusil 10.0:1 CR   $780  
  Rings, 87mm Moly Rings   $120  
  Rod Bearings, Sport Aluminum Face   $60  
  Main Bearings with 360° Thrust Oiling Groove   $120  
         
2100 HiFlo ST Rally M42 Engine Kit 205 HP $5,995 + Full Kit Discount
  HiFlo ST Rally Head*, 6% Flow Increase   $1,495 $600
  Head Upgrade, from 7mm to 6mm Valvetrain   $300  
  Cam Pair, Intake 272° & Exhaust 258°   $900  
  Head Gasket   $110  
  Pistons, Rally 87mm Forged Alusil 11.5:1 CR   $780  
  Rings, 87mm Moly Rings   $120  
  Rods, Rally 138mm, UltraLite "I" Beam Rod, 475 grams   $780  
  or Rods, Rally 138mm "H" Beam Rods, 520 grams   $780  
  Rod Bearings, Teflon Coated Tri-Metal   $140  
  Main Bearings with 360° Thrust Oiling Groove   $120  
  M42 88mm Forged Steel Crank Kit   $1,250

Keep in mind you'd probably want to add a lightened flywheel ($875) and a pulse chamber intake manifold ($1000), but I'd be surprised if there wasn't some sort of discount on these items.
